❓ FAQ
Q: Can I use the GoSports enclosure with a projector? A: Yes. The HD impact screen is designed for projection with a short-throw or ultra-short-throw projector. The 4:3 aspect ratio works well with GSPro, E6 Connect, and Home Tee Hero.
Q: Does the Carl’s Place DIY kit include the frame pipes? A: No. The base kit includes the impact screen, side netting, and connectors. You need to either add the Pipe Framing Kit (~$100–$150) or supply your own 1-inch EMT conduit from a hardware store.
Q: What’s the difference between SIGPRO Softy and Softy LITE? A: The Softy LITE is a thinner, lighter version designed for tighter budgets or temporary setups. The full Softy has a thicker foam core and replaceable hitting strip, making it more durable for long-term use. The LITE is ~$100–$200 cheaper.
Q: Do I need a landing mat? A: Not strictly required, but highly recommended. A landing mat protects your floor from ball impact, prevents balls from bouncing under the screen, and gives the room a professional finished look. Budget option: a 5×8 turf pad from Rain or Shine at $349.
